Best Cooking Oils for Health: A Complete Guide

Selecting the right cooking oil is a critical dietary choice for supporting good health and overall well-being. The type of oil you choose can significantly impact your cholesterol levels, inflammation, and nutrient absorption. Quality oils provide essential fatty acids that support brain function, cell membranes, and hormone production. Conversely, excessive consumption of fats high in trans fats and certain saturated fats is associated with an increased risk of heart disease. By opting for minimally processed oils rich in monounsaturated (MUFAs) and polyunsaturated (PUFAs) fats, you can promote long-term well-being and enhance the nutritional value of your meals. Let’s explore what makes an oil “healthy” and the factors to consider when choosing the best oils for your kitchen.

What Factors Decide the Best Cooking Oils?

When it comes to identifying beneficial cooking oils, several key factors must be considered to ensure safety and efficacy.

  • Smoke Point: The smoke point is the temperature at which an oil begins to break down and emit visible smoke, potentially forming harmful compounds [1]. Oils with high smoke points, such as refined avocado oil (up to 520°F or 271°C) and refined olive oil (up to 465°F or 240°C), are suitable for frying and high-heat cooking. It’s important to match the oil’s smoke point to the cooking method to prevent this breakdown. In contrast, unrefined oils, like flaxseed oil, are better suited for dressings and low-heat applications due to their lower smoke points [1].
  • Fat Content: Focus on oils that contain a high proportion of beneficial unsaturated fats (MUFAs and PUFAs), such as extra-virgin olive oil (~73% monounsaturated) or avocado oil. These fats can help lower LDL (“bad”) cholesterol levels and support overall cardiovascular health [5].
  • Nutrients and Processing: Unrefined oils retain more of their natural antioxidants, such as polyphenols in olive oil, and Vitamin E [5]. These bioactive compounds have been linked to cellular protection against oxidative stress and reduced inflammation. Generally, less processed oils retain more volatile compounds that contribute to both flavor and health benefits.

Top Beneficial Cooking Oils

Among the top contenders for versatility and cardiovascular support are olive, avocado, sesame, and high-oleic safflower oils.

1. Olive Oil: The Mediterranean Standard

Extra virgin olive oil (EVOO) is highly valued for its high percentage of monounsaturated fats and powerful polyphenol antioxidants, like oleocanthal. These nutrients work together to help reduce inflammation and lower LDL cholesterol levels [2]. Specifically, the high oleic acid content is known to support cardiovascular health [5]. With a moderately low smoke point of around 375°F (190°C), EVOO is best suited for sautéing, baking, and cold applications like dressings. For higher heat applications, a “light” or “refined” olive oil with a higher smoke point can be used.

2. Avocado Oil: Nutrient-Rich and High-Heat Versatile

Avocado oil boasts an impressive average of 70% monounsaturated fat content, along with the antioxidant lutein, which is known to support eye health [5]. Its high smoke point of up to 520°F (271°C) makes it a highly versatile choice for frying and grilling without compromising its nutritional value [1]. Limited clinical research suggests that avocado oil can help maintain healthy cholesterol profiles and enhance the absorption of fat-soluble vitamins (e.g., A, D, E, K) from accompanying vegetables [5].

3. Sesame Oil: A Flavorful and Antioxidant-Rich Option

Unrefined sesame oil is a treasure trove of antioxidants, particularly sesamin and sesaminol, which combat oxidative stress and may support liver function. Its distinctive nutty flavor is a perfect complement to Asian stir-fries and marinades. Clinical trials have indicated that the lignans found in sesame oil may help modestly lower blood pressure and improve the lipid profile in individuals with mild hypertension [3]. Light sesame oil (refined) has a higher smoke point of 410°F (210°C), making it suitable for moderate-to-high-temperature cooking. Toasted sesame oil, however, is best reserved for adding flavor to dishes after cooking, as its flavor compounds can break down easily.

4. Safflower Oil (High-Oleic): A Stable Choice

High-oleic safflower oil is predominantly composed of monounsaturated fats (over 75%). This composition makes it remarkably stable for cooking, with a high smoke point of 450°F (232°C). Small-scale human studies have suggested that high-oleic safflower oil may help reduce LDL cholesterol levels and may offer support for blood sugar control in certain populations. Although it lacks the high polyphenol content of extra virgin olive oil, it remains cardioprotective due to its favorable unsaturated fat profile.

Which Oils to Use with Caution in Cooking?

While cooking oils are an important part of meal preparation, some oils require judicious and balanced consumption.

  • Oils High in Omega-6 PUFAs: Oils such as sunflower oil, corn oil, and conventional soybean oil contain significant amounts of omega-6 fatty acids. While essential for the body, the typical modern Indian and Western diet often contains an imbalance, favoring excessive levels of Omega-6s over Omega-3s [6]. An excessive ratio (far beyond the recommended 4:1) may potentially promote inflammation in certain metabolic pathways [6]. It is advisable to prioritize a variety of oils rich in MUFAs and Omega-3s (like flaxseed oil) to help maintain a balanced fatty acid intake.
  • Coconut Oil (A Note on Saturated Fats): Coconut oil is often debated because it contains over 80% saturated fat, primarily lauric acid. While some research suggests lauric acid is metabolized differently than long-chain saturated fats, multiple studies have shown it significantly raises both LDL (“bad”) and HDL (“good”) cholesterol levels [4]. Major health organizations, including the American Heart Association and the Indian Heart Association, strongly recommend limiting total saturated fat intake to reduce cardiovascular risk [6]. Therefore, coconut oil should be used sparingly and in moderation in your cooking.

Best Oils for Different Cooking Methods

Selecting the appropriate oil for various cooking techniques is crucial to ensure both culinary success and nutritional integrity.

  • Frying (High-Heat): Use oils with high smoke points that resist oxidation, such as refined avocado oil, refined olive oil (light), or high-oleic sunflower/safflower oil [1]. These oils maintain stability at high temperatures, making them ideal for deep-frying or stir-frying.
  • Sautéing (Moderate-Heat): For sautéing, oils like Extra Virgin Olive Oil (EVOO) and canola oil are excellent choices. They have moderate smoke points and are rich in heart-healthy unsaturated fats.
  • Drizzling over Salads or Finishing Dishes: For cold applications, use cold-pressed Extra Virgin Olive Oil, walnut oil, or flaxseed oil. These oils have rich flavors and are high in sensitive nutrients, including Omega-3 fatty acids (in walnut and flaxseed), which are easily damaged by heat and therefore best consumed raw.
  • Baking: For baking, canola oil and light olive oil are suitable choices due to their neutral flavor and moderate heat tolerance.

Storage Tips for Cooking Oils

Proper storage is essential to preserve the quality and nutritional value of your cooking oils and prevent rancidity.

  • Store your oils in opaque or dark glass bottles to protect them from light exposure.
  • Keep your oils in a cool, dry place away from heat sources like the stove or direct sunlight.
  • Use airtight containers to minimize air exposure.
  • Label your oil containers with the purchase or opening date to ensure you use them while they are still fresh.

Frequently Asked Question (FAQs)

What is the healthiest cooking oil?

Extra Virgin Olive Oil (EVOO) is often considered the healthiest cooking oil for daily use due to its rich content of heart-healthy monounsaturated fats, polyphenols, and established anti-inflammatory properties, supported by extensive clinical data [2].

Can I use olive oil for frying?

Extra Virgin Olive Oil (EVOO) is best suited for lower-heat sautéing and baking (below 375°F/190°C) or for cold applications. For high-heat frying, a refined “light” olive oil or another high-smoke-point oil like refined avocado oil is a better, more stable choice [1].

What is the best cooking oil for high-heat cooking?

Refined Avocado Oil is ideal for high-heat cooking due to its exceptionally high smoke point of up to 520°F (271°C), making it a stable and healthy choice for frying [1].

Is coconut oil bad for health?

Coconut oil is controversial due to its extremely high saturated fat content (over 80%). While it raises both HDL and LDL cholesterol, major health organizations recommend limiting its use to small, moderate amounts to control overall saturated fat intake [4, 6].

What is the difference between refined and unrefined oils?

Unrefined oils are minimally processed, retaining more flavor, color, and beneficial nutrients (like polyphenols) but often have lower smoke points. Refined oils are filtered and treated to remove impurities, resulting in a neutral taste, higher smoke point, and longer shelf life, making them suitable for high-heat cooking.
